Abstract

The utility model discloses a light and quick photovoltaic frame easy to install, and relates to the technical field of photovoltaic frames. The side plate assembly comprises a frame body, an installation bolt, a fixing piece and a reinforcing piece, wherein the frame body comprises a side plate body, an assembly installation cavity is formed in the upper portion of one side of the side plate body, a plurality of strip-shaped grooves are formed in the side plate body side by side, the fixing piece comprises a bottom plate, an inner plate body and an outer plate body are fixed on the bottom plate, the bottom plate is arranged on the lower portion of the side plate body through the inner plate body and the outer plate body, a group of clamping blocks are arranged on the inner side of the top end of the outer plate body, and the fixing piece is clamped with the side plate body through the clamping blocks and the strip-shaped grooves. According to the photovoltaic frame, the bottom plate on the original frame body is removed, the lightening holes and the strip-shaped grooves are formed in the side plate body, the light weight of the frame is achieved, meanwhile, the fixing piece matched with the frame body is designed for fixing the frame and the photovoltaic support, the frame is pre-fixed through the fixture blocks and the strip-shaped grooves, and then the frame and the photovoltaic support are installed, so that the photovoltaic frame is easy to install.

Background
Current photovoltaic frame sets up the curb plate body and is the main part, and curb plate body upper portion sets up the installation that the subassembly installation cavity is used for photovoltaic module, and curb plate body bottom sets up the bottom plate to set up the mounting hole and be used for being connected between frame and the photovoltaic support on the bottom plate, set up the setting that the riser is used for the angle sign indicating number simultaneously, the volume is great and the structure is great, and weight is great, is unfavorable for staff's transportation and removal, is unfavorable for the operation.
The mounting hole is predetermine at the bottom plate on the frame simultaneously and is used for fixing with the photovoltaic support, if the deviation appears in photovoltaic support mounting hole, then need trompil again, difficult operation, if carry out the setting of photovoltaic support mounting hole again when the installation, then complex operation to probably cause photovoltaic frame, photovoltaic support and photovoltaic module's damage at the trompil in-process, be unfavorable for staff's operation and installation.
SUMMERY OF THE UTILITY MODEL
The utility model aims to provide a light photovoltaic frame easy to install, which is characterized in that a bottom plate on an original frame body is removed, lightening holes and strip-shaped grooves are formed in a side plate body, so that the light weight of the frame is realized, meanwhile, a fixing piece matched with the frame body is designed for fixing the frame and a photovoltaic support, the frame and the photovoltaic support are pre-fixed through a clamping block and the strip-shaped grooves, and then the frame and the photovoltaic support are installed, so that the light photovoltaic frame is easy to install.
In order to solve the technical problems, the utility model is realized by the following technical scheme:
the utility model relates to an easily-installed and light photovoltaic frame which comprises a frame body, an installation bolt, a fixing piece and a reinforcing piece, wherein the frame body comprises a side plate body, and an assembly installation cavity is arranged at the upper part of one side of the side plate body;
a plurality of strip-shaped grooves are formed in the side plate body side by side;
the fixing piece comprises a bottom plate, an inner plate body and an outer plate body are fixed on the bottom plate, and the bottom plate is arranged at the lower part of the side plate body through the inner plate body and the outer plate body;
a group of clamping blocks are arranged on the inner side of the top end of the outer plate body, and the fixing piece is clamped with the side plate body through the clamping blocks and the strip-shaped grooves;
the reinforcing piece comprises a rope body and a fixing ring, a convex edge is arranged on the peripheral side face of the fixing ring, one end of the rope body is fixed on the convex edge, a screw rod is fixed at the other end of the rope body, the screw rod penetrates through the strip-shaped groove and the outer plate body and is in threaded connection with a nut, and the screw rod is located between the clamping blocks;
the fixing ring is fixed with the bottom plate through a mounting bolt.
Further, the assembly installation cavity comprises an upper plate body and a lower plate body, and the upper plate body and the lower plate body are fixed on the upper portion of one side of the side plate body in parallel.
Furthermore, a plurality of lightening holes are formed in the side plate body and at the position located at the lower part of the strip-shaped groove side by side, and the top surface of the inner plate body is located between the lightening holes and the strip-shaped groove.
Furthermore, a reinforcing plate is fixed between the bottom plate and the inner plate body, and the reinforcing plate is of an inclined plate structure.
Further, the fixture block is of a right-angled triangle structure or a right-angled trapezoid structure, the inclined surface of the fixture block faces upwards, and the distance between the bottom surface of the fixture block and the bottom plate is consistent with the distance between the strip-shaped groove and the bottom surface of the side plate body.
Further, the mounting bolt includes a screw portion, a nut portion, and a nut portion, the screw portion penetrating the base plate, the fixing ring and the base plate being located between the nut portion and the nut portion.
Furthermore, the bottom plate is provided with mounting holes, the mounting holes are waist-shaped holes, and the mounting holes are perpendicular to the frame body.
The utility model has the following beneficial effects:
1. according to the photovoltaic frame, the bottom plate on the original frame body is removed, the lightening holes and the strip-shaped grooves are formed in the side plate body, the frame strength is guaranteed, meanwhile, the weight of the frame is greatly reduced, the light weight of the frame is achieved, meanwhile, the fixing piece matched with the frame body is designed for fixing the frame and the photovoltaic support, the frame is pre-fixed through the fixture blocks and the strip-shaped grooves, and then the frame and the photovoltaic support are installed, so that the photovoltaic frame is easy to install.
2. According to the utility model, by designing the movable fixing piece and arranging the waist-shaped mounting holes on the bottom plate on the fixing piece, the mounting holes do not need to be preset on the frame, meanwhile, the mounting holes can be preset between the photovoltaics, the positions of the mounting holes on the photovoltaic support do not need to be accurately set, the mounting holes do not need to be arranged during mounting, only the mounting is carried out according to the positions of the mounting holes, and the mounting is easy.
3. According to the utility model, the outer plate body can be pulled through designing the reinforcing piece, the inner plate body can be supported through the designed reinforcing plate, the problem that the outer plate body and the inner plate body are loosened is avoided, and the fixing capacity between the fixing piece and the frame is ensured.

Referring to fig. 1-2, the utility model is an easy-to-mount light photovoltaic frame, which includes a frame 1, a mounting bolt 2, a fixing member 3 and a reinforcing member 4, wherein the frame 1 includes a side plate 101, and an assembly mounting cavity 102 is formed at the upper part of one side of the side plate 101;
a plurality of grooves 103 are arranged on the side plate body 101 side by side;
the fixing piece 3 comprises a bottom plate 301, an inner plate body 302 and an outer plate body 303 are fixed on the bottom plate 301, and the bottom plate 301 is arranged at the lower part of the side plate body 101 through the inner plate body 302 and the outer plate body 303;
a group of clamping blocks 305 are arranged on the inner side of the top end of the outer plate body 303, and the fixing piece 3 is clamped with the side plate body 101 through the clamping blocks 305 and the strip-shaped grooves 103;
the reinforcing member 4 comprises a rope body 401 and a fixing ring 402, a convex edge 403 is arranged on the circumferential side surface of the fixing ring 402, one end of the rope body 401 is fixed on the convex edge 403, a screw 404 is fixed at the other end of the rope body 401, the screw 404 penetrates through the strip-shaped groove 103 and the outer plate body 303 and is in threaded connection with a nut 405, and the screw 404 is located between the clamping blocks 305;
the fixing ring 402 is fixed to the base plate 301 by the mounting bolt 2.
As shown in fig. 1-2, the module installation cavity 102 includes an upper plate 104 and a lower plate 105, and the upper plate 104 and the lower plate 105 are fixed in parallel on an upper portion of one side of the side plate 101.
As shown in fig. 1-2, a plurality of lightening holes 106 are formed in the side plate body 101 and at the lower portion of the strip-shaped groove 103 in parallel, and the top surface of the inner plate body 302 is located between the lightening holes 106 and the strip-shaped groove 103.
As shown in fig. 2, a reinforcing plate 304 is fixed between the bottom plate 301 and the inner plate 302, and the reinforcing plate 304 is of an inclined plate structure.
As shown in fig. 2, the latch 305 has a right triangle structure or a right trapezoid structure, the inclined surface of the latch 305 faces upward, and the distance between the bottom surface of the latch 305 and the bottom plate 301 is the same as the distance between the strip-shaped groove 103 and the bottom surface of the side plate 101.
As shown in fig. 2, the mounting bolt 2 includes a screw portion 201, a nut portion 202, and a nut portion 203, the screw portion 201 penetrates the base plate 301, and the fixing ring 402 and the base plate 301 are located between the nut portion 202 and the nut portion 203.
Wherein, the bottom plate 301 is provided with a mounting hole, the mounting hole is a waist-shaped hole, and the mounting hole is vertically distributed with the frame body 1.
The working principle of the utility model is as follows: clamping between the bottom plate 301 and the side plate body 101 is achieved through the clamping blocks 305 and the strip-shaped grooves 103 for pre-fixing, the screw rod portion 201 sequentially penetrates through the photovoltaic support, the bottom plate 301 and the fixing ring 402 and is screwed with the nut portion 202, the screw rod 404 at the other end of the rope body 401 penetrates through the outer plate body 303 and is screwed with the nut 405 to achieve tightening of the rope body 401, and installation is completed.
